The Technical of Expansion PVC

Novos Expandido PVC Compound is specially engineered for the production of lightweight and comfortable footwear soles. Through advanced formulation technology and strict quality control, the compound achieves excellent foaming performance while maintaining strong mechanical properties and stable processing behavior.

The material creates a uniform microcellular structure throughout the sole, resulting in lower density, improved cushioning, and enhanced wearer comfort. Its stable chemical composition allows high-temperature processing without degradation, ensuring consistent quality during mass production.

Expandido PVC Compound also offers excellent colorability, abrasion resistance, and hardness customization, making it suitable for fashion footwear, casual shoes, sandals, slippers, and other lightweight sole applications.

Ultra-Lightweight with Excellent Foaming Performance

The optimized foaming system enables finished sole density as low as 0.40 g/cm³ under ideal production conditions. The expansion process creates a highly uniform cellular structure, helping manufacturers achieve lighter footwear without sacrificing performance. Even under 80× microscopic magnification, the cell distribution remains remarkably consistent, contributing to better cushioning, flexibility, and product appearance.

Stable Quality and Reliable Durability

The compound features a stable chemical structure designed for demanding manufacturing environments. It can withstand processing temperatures up to 190°C while maintaining excellent physical properties. The material also provides easy pigmentation, consistent color dispersion, and strong abrasion resistance, making it suitable for long-term use in everyday footwear applications.

Technical Performance Analysis

Our PVC compounds undergo rigorous rheological testing to ensure consistent thermodynamic properties for high-speed injection molding.

Property Test Method Unit Specification
Specific Gravity ASTM D792 g/cm³ 0.50 ± 0.02
Shore Hardness ISO 868 Shore A 65 ± 2 (Customizable)
Abrasion Resistance DIN 53516 mm³ ≤ 300
Available Colors Visual - Fully Customizable

Data values represent average laboratory results and can be modified to meet specific shoe sole mold requirements.

Compliant with international safety standards including REACH SVHC and RoHS 3.0 directives.

Frequently Asked Questions

1. What is the lowest density achievable with Expandido PVC Compound? +
Under optimized production conditions, finished sole density can reach approximately 0.40 g/cm³, depending on mold design and processing parameters.
2. Is the foam structure uniform throughout the sole?+
Yes. The compound is designed to create a highly uniform cellular structure. Even under 80× magnification, the foam cells remain evenly distributed.
3. What processing temperature can this compound withstand? +
Novos Expandido PVC Compound offers excellent thermal stability and can be processed at temperatures up to 190°C.
4. Can hardness be customized? +
Yes. We can adjust hardness according to your footwear design requirements, allowing different comfort and performance characteristics.
5. What types of footwear are suitable for this material? +
The compound is ideal for fashion shoes, sandals, slippers, casual footwear, children's shoes, and other lightweight sole applications.
